Collins Chinese-English Dictionary

名字 [míngzi]
  1. 1. noun name
    你叫什么名字
    What's your name?

Comprehensive Chinese-English Dictionary

名字 [míngzi]
  1. 1. name or given name
    您叫什么名字
    What's your name? or May I know your name?
  2. 2. name (of a thing)
    这种花的名字很特别。
    This flower has a peculiar name.

Contemporary Standard Chinese Dictionary

名字 [míngzi]
  1. 1. 原为名和字的合称;现指人的姓名,也单指名。
  2. 2. 事物的名称
    这条河的名字叫子牙河。

Examples

顶别人的名字
assume sb. else's name
这个名字好耳熟,好像在广播里听到过。
The name sounds so familiar, I seem to have heard it mentioned over the radio.
他把自己的名字工工整整地写在书的衬页上。
He carefully wrote his name on the flyleaf.
他供出了主犯的名字
He gave the name of the chief culprit.
把他的名字勾掉
cross out his name; strike his name off the register
我还没有来得及问他名字,他就把电话挂了。
He hung up (or rang off) before I could ask his name.
他的脸我还认得,可是他的名字我却回忆不起来了。
I remember his face, but I can't call his name to mind.
这种花的名字很特别。
This flower has a peculiar name.
看他面熟,名字可叫不上来。
I know his face but I can't recall his name.
